Fill in the blanks.
Adam has four times as many stickers as Bryan.
Both give away 10 stickers each.
In the end, Adam has six times as many stickers as Bryan.
- Difference in the number of stickers between Adam and Bryan = _____ u
- Number of stickers that Adam and Bryan have in the end = _____ u
- Number of stickers that Adam gives away = _____ u
- 1 u = _____

(a)
Change X times into units.
The difference in the number of stickers that Adam and Bryan have at first and in the end is the same.
LCM of 3 and 5 is 15.
Difference in the number of stickers between Adam and Bryan
= 20 u - 5 u
= 15 u
(b)
Number of stickers that Adam and Bryan had in the end
= 18 u + 3 u
= 21 u
(c)
Number of stickers that Adam gives away
= 20 u - 18 u
= 2 u
(d)
2 u = 10
1 u = 10 ÷ 2 = 5
Answer(s): (a) 15 ; (b) 21; (c) 2 ; (d) 5
